WebJul 21, 2024 · The meeting chair, sometimes known as a chairperson, is the elected officer of an organized body, such as a board or committee. During the meeting, it's the role of the chair to prepare the meeting agenda, begin the meeting, encourage discussion, and keep the discussion focused and balanced. WebApr 22, 2024 · Running Meetings Download Article 1 Take the head seat. If there is a head seat in the room you are using, it's appropriate for you to take it. You are the leader, and you are visually establishing that by taking the head seat. [10] On the other hand, if you want to establish a more informal setting, you might sit in the middle of the group.
